JEE / JEE Main 2027 / Math / Sequences and Series Section 3 of 6 40 min read Medium Practice — Set 1 Quick Recap — AP Sums & Means Sn=n2(2a+(n−1)d)S_n=\tfrac n2\big(2a+(n-1)d\big)Sn=2n(2a+(n−1)d); nth term from sums: an=Sn−Sn−1a_n=S_n-S_{n-1}an=Sn−Sn−1. Inserting kkk AMs between aaa and bbb: common difference d=b−ak+1d=\dfrac{b-a}{k+1}d=k+1b−a. ∑n=n(n+1)2\sum n=\tfrac{n(n+1)}{2}∑n=2n(n+1), sum of first nnn evens =n(n+1)=n(n+1)=n(n+1). Three numbers in AP: take them a−d, a, a+da-d,\,a,\,a+da−d,a,a+d. Ready to test your knowledge? Take a quick interactive quiz on this topic — free, works without login.
